This modul extracts thunderstorm warnings from <a href="https://www.unwetterzentrale.de">www.unwetterzentrale.de</a>.
<br/>
Therefore the same interface is used as the Android App <a href="https://www.alertspro.com">Alerts Pro</a> does.
A maximum of 10 thunderstorm warnings will be served.
Additional the module provides a few functions to create HTML-Templates which can be used with weblink.
<br>
<i>The following Perl-Modules are used within this module: HTTP::Request, LWP::UserAgent, JSON, Encode::Guess und HTML::Parse</i>.

<b>Define</b>
<ul>
<br>
<code>define &lt;Name&gt; UWZ [CountryCode] [AreaID] [INTERVAL]</code>
<br><br><br>
Example:
<br>
<code>
define Unwetterzentrale UWZ UK 08357 1800<br>
attr Unwetterzentrale download 1<br>
attr Unwetterzentrale humanreadable 1<br>
attr Unwetterzentrale maps eastofengland unitedkingdom<br><br>
define UnwetterDetails weblink htmlCode {FHEM::UWZ::UWZAsHtml("Unwetterzentrale")}<br>
define UnwetterMapE_UK weblink htmlCode {FHEM::UWZ::UWZAsHtmlKarteLand("Unwetterzentrale","eastofengland")}<br>
define UnwetterLite weblink htmlCode {FHEM::UWZ::UWZAsHtmlLite("Unwetterzentrale")}
define UnwetterMovie weblink htmlCode {FHEM::UWZ::UWZAsHtmlMovie("Unwetterzentrale","clouds-precipitation-uk")}
</code>
<br>&nbsp;
<li><code>[CountryCode]</code>
<br>
Possible values: DE, AT, CH, UK, ...<br/>
(for other countries than germany use SEARCH for CountryCode to start device in search mode)
</li><br>
<li><code>[AreaID]</code>
<br>
For Germany you can use the postalcode, other countries use SEARCH for CountryCode to start device in search mode.
<br>
</li><br>
<li><code>[INTERVAL]</code>
<br>
Defines the refresh interval. The interval is defined in seconds, so an interval of 3600 means that every hour a refresh will be triggered onetimes.
<br>
</li><br>
<br><br><br>
Example Search-Mode:
<br>
<code>
define Unwetterzentrale UWZ SEARCH<br>
</code>
<br>
now get the AreaID for your location (example shows london):
<br>
<code>
get Unwetterzentrale SearchAreaID London<br>
</code>
<br>
now redefine your device with the outputted CountryCode and AreaID.
<br>
<br>&nbsp;
</ul>

<a name="UWZattr"></a>
<b>Attributes</b>
<ul>
<br>
<li><code>download</code>
<br>
Download maps during update (0|1).
<br>
</li>
<li><code>savepath</code>
<br>
Define where to store the map png files (default: /tmp/).
<br>
</li>
<li><code>maps</code>
<br>
Define the maps to download space seperated. For possible values see <code>UWZAsHtmlKarteLand</code>.
<br>
</li>
<li><code>humanreadable</code>
<br>
Add additional Readings Warn_?_Start_Date, Warn_?_Start_Time, Warn_?_End_Date and Warn_?_End_Time containing the coresponding timetamp in a human readable manner. Additionally Warn_?_uwzLevel_Str and Warn_?_Type_Str will be added to device readings (0|1).
<br>
</li>
<li><code>lang</code>
<br>
Overwrite requested language for short and long warn text. (de|en|it|fr|es|..).
<br>
</li>
<li><code>sort_readings_by</code>
<br>
define how readings will be sortet (start|severity|creation).
<br>
</li>
<li><code>htmlsequence</code>
<br>
define warn order of html output (ascending|descending).
<br>
</li>
<li><code>htmltitle</code>
<br>
title / header for the html ouput
<br>
</li>
<li><code>htmltitleclass</code>
<br>
css-Class of title / header for the html ouput
<br>
</li>
<li><code>localiconbase</code>
<br>
define baseurl to host your own thunderstorm warn pics (filetype is png).
<br>
</li>
<li><code>intervalAtWarnLevel</code>
<br>
define the interval per warnLevel. Example: 2=1800,3=900,4=300
<br>
</li>
<br>
</ul>

<a name="UWZreading"></a>
<b>Readings</b>
<ul>
<br>
<li><b>Warn_</b><i>0|1|2|3...|9</i><b>_...</b> - active warnings</li>
<li><b>WarnCount</b> - warnings count</li>
<li><b>WarnUWZLevel</b> - total warn level </li>
<li><b>WarnUWZLevel_Color</b> - total warn level color</li>
<li><b>WarnUWZLevel_Str</b> - total warn level string</li>
<li><b>Warn_</b><i>0</i><b>_AltitudeMin</b> - minimum altitude for warning </li>
<li><b>Warn_</b><i>0</i><b>_AltitudeMax</b> - maximum altitude for warning </li>
<li><b>Warn_</b><i>0</i><b>_EventID</b> - warning EventID </li>
<li><b>Warn_</b><i>0</i><b>_Creation</b> - warning creation </li>
<li><b>Warn_</b><i>0</i><b>_Creation_Date</b> - warning creation datum </li>
<li><b>Warn_</b><i>0</i><b>_Creation_Time</b> - warning creation time </li>
<li><b>currentIntervalMode</b> - default/warn, Interval is read from INTERVAL or INTERVALWARN Internal</li>
<li><b>Warn_</b><i>0</i><b>_Start</b> - begin of warnperiod</li>
<li><b>Warn_</b><i>0</i><b>_Start_Date</b> - start date of warnperiod</li>
<li><b>Warn_</b><i>0</i><b>_Start_Time</b> - start time of warnperiod</li>
<li><b>Warn_</b><i>0</i><b>_End</b> - end of warnperiod</li>
<li><b>Warn_</b><i>0</i><b>_End_Date</b> - end date of warnperiod</li>
<li><b>Warn_</b><i>0</i><b>_End_Time</b> - end time of warnperiod</li>
<li><b>Warn_</b><i>0</i><b>_Severity</b> - Severity of thunderstorm (0 no thunderstorm, 4, 7, 11, .. heavy thunderstorm)</li>
<li><b>Warn_</b><i>0</i><b>_Hail</b> - warning contains hail</li>
<li><b>Warn_</b><i>0</i><b>_Type</b> - kind of thunderstorm</li>
<li><b>Warn_</b><i>0</i><b>_Type_Str</b> - kind of thunderstorm (text)</li>
<ul>
<li><b>1</b> - unknown</li>
<li><b>2</b> - storm</li>
<li><b>3</b> - snow</li>
<li><b>4</b> - rain</li>
<li><b>5</b> - frost</li>
<li><b>6</b> - forest fire</li>
<li><b>7</b> - thunderstorm</li>
<li><b>8</b> - glaze</li>
<li><b>9</b> - heat</li>
<li><b>10</b> - freezing rain</li>
<li><b>11</b> - soil frost</li>
</ul>
<li><b>Warn_</b><i>0</i><b>_uwzLevel</b> - Severity of thunderstorm (0-5)</li>
<li><b>Warn_</b><i>0</i><b>_uwzLevel_Str</b> - Severity of thunderstorm (text)</li>
<li><b>Warn_</b><i>0</i><b>_levelName</b> - Level Warn Name</li>
<li><b>Warn_</b><i>0</i><b>_ShortText</b> - short warn text</li>
<li><b>Warn_</b><i>0</i><b>_LongText</b> - detailed warn text</li>
<li><b>Warn_</b><i>0</i><b>_IconURL</b> - cumulated URL to display warn-icons from <a href="https://www.unwetterzentrale.de">www.unwetterzentrale.de</a></li>
</ul>
